I John
1:1 That which was from the beginning, what we have heard and have seen with our own eyes, that we have looked upon and our hands have handled, of the Word of Life;1:2 (For the Life was made visible and we have seen it, and bear witness, and bring tidings to you that Age-Lasting Life, that was with the Father, and was made visible to us;)1:3 What we have seen and heard we declare to you, that you also may have fellowship with us: and truly our fellowship is with the Father, and with His Son Jesus Christ.1:4 And these things we write to you, that your joy may be full.1:5 This then is the message that we have heard from him and declare to you, THAT ELOHIM IS LIGHT, AND IN HIM IS NO DARKNESS AT ALL.1:6 If we say that we have fellowship with him, and walk in darkness, we lie, and produce not the Truth:1:7 But if we walk in the Light, as he is in the Light, we have fellowship one with another, and the blood of Jesus Christ his Son cleanses us from all sin.1:8 If we say that we have no sin, we deceive ourselves, and the Truth is not in us.1:9 If we confess our sins, he is faithful and righteous to forgive us our sins, and to cleanse us from all unrighteousness.1:10 If we say that we have not sinned, we make him a liar, and his Word is not in us.
2:1 My little children, these things I write to you that you sin not. And if anyone sin, we have an advocate with the Father, Jesus Christ the righteous:2:2 And he is the propitiation for our sins: and not for ours only, but also for the sins of the whole cosmos.2:3 And in this we know that we have known him, if his commands we may observe.2:4 He that says, I know him, and observes not his commandments, is a liar and the Truth is not in him.2:5 But whoever observes his Word, in him truly is the Love of Elohim made perfect: by this we know that we are in him.2:6 He that says he abides in him should himself also be walking, even as he walked.2:7 Brethren, I write no new commandment to you, but an old commandment that you had from the beginning. The old commandment is the Word that you have heard from the beginning.2:8 Again, a new commandment I write to you, this thing is true in him and in you: because the darkness has past and the True Light now shines.2:9 He that says he is in the Light, and hates his brother, is in darkness even until now.2:10 He that loves his brother abides in the Light, and there is no occasion of stumbling in him.2:11 But he that hates his brother is in darkness and walks in darkness, and knows not where he goes, because that darkness has blinded his eyes.2:12 I write to you, little children, because your sins are forgiven you for his Name's sake.2:13 I write to you, fathers, because you have known him that is from the beginning. I write to you, young men, because you have conquered hardships. I write to you, little children, because you have known the Father.2:14 I have written to you, fathers, because you have known Him that is from the beginning. I have written to you, young men, because you are strong, and the Word of Elohim remains in you, and you have conquered hardships.2:15 Love not the world, neither the things that are in the world. If anyone love the world, the Love of the Father is not in him.2:16 For all that is in the world, the lust of the flesh and the lust of the eyes, and the pride of life, is not of the Father but is of the world.2:17 And the world passes away, and its lust: but he that does the will of Elohim remains for the ages.2:18 Little youths, it is the last hour; and even as you heard that the Antichrist does come, even now antichrists have become many, by this we know that it is the last hour.2:19 They went out from us, but they were not of us; for if they had been of us, they would no doubt have continued with us: but they went out that they might be made visible that they were not all of us.2:20 But you have an anointing from the Holy One, and you know all things.2:21 I have not written to you because you know not the Truth, but because you know it, and that no lie is of the Truth.2:22 Who is a liar but he that denies that Jesus is the Christ? He is antichrist, that denies the Father and the Son.2:23 Whoever denies the Son, the same has not the Father, but he that acknowledges the Son has the Father also.2:24 Let that therefore remain in you, what you have heard from the beginning. If what you have heard from the beginning will remain in you, you will also continue in the Son, and in the Father.2:25 And this is the promise that he has promised us, even Age-Lasting Life.2:26 These things I have written to you concerning them that go astray.2:27 But the anointing that you have received from him abides in you. And you have no need that anyone may teach you, but as the same anointing does teach you concerning all, and is true, and is not a lie, and even as was taught you, you will remain in him.2:28 And now, little children, remain in him; that when he will appear, we may have confidence, and not be ashamed before him at his Advent.2:29 If you know that he is righteous, you know that everyone that produces righteousness is begotten of him.
3:1 Observe what quality of Love the Father has bestowed upon us, that we should be called the sons of Elohim: therefore the world knows us not, because it knew him not.3:2 Beloved, now we are the sons of Elohim, and it does not yet appear what we will be: but we know that when he will appear, we will be resembling him; for we will see him as he is.3:3 And everyone that has this expectation in them cleanses themselves, even as they are clean.3:4 Whoever commits sin transgresses also the Law: for sin is lawlessness.3:5 And you know that he was made visible to take away our sins; and in him is no sin.3:6 Whoever remains in him sins not: whoever sins has not seen him, neither known him.3:7 Little children, let no one deceive you: He that produces righteousness is righteous, even as he is righteous.3:8 He that produces sin is of the Devil; because from the beginning the Devil does sin; for this was the Son of Elohim made visible, that he may break up the works of the Devil.3:9 Whoever is begotten of Elohim does not commit sin; because his seed lives in him: and he cannot sin, because he is begotten of Elohim.3:10 In this the children of Elohim are made visible, and the children of the Devil: whoever produces not righteousness is not of Elohim, neither he that is not fond of his brother.3:11 Because this is the message that you heard from the beginning, that we should love dearly one another.3:12 Not as Cain, who was of the bad and killed his brother. And why did he kill him? Because his own works were bad, but his brother's were righteous.3:13 Wonder not my brethren, if the world hates you.3:14 We know that we have passed from death to Life, because we love the brethren. He that loves not his brother remains in darkness.3:15 Whoever hates his brother is a murderer: and you know that no murderer has Age-Lasting Life abiding in him.3:16 Hereby we perceive the Love of Elohim, because he laid down his Life for us: and we should be laying down our lives for the brethren.3:17 But whoever has this world's wealth, seeing his brother has need, and shuts up his bowels of compassion from him, how remains the Love of Elohim in him?3:18 My little children, let us not Love in word, neither in tongue; but in deed and in Truth.3:19 And by this we know that we are of the Truth, and will persuade our hearts before him.3:20 Because if our heart condemns us, Elohim is greater than our heart, and knows all things.3:21 Beloved, if our heart condemns us not, then we have confidence toward Elohim.3:22 And whatever we ask we receive of him, because we observe his commandments, and do those things that are pleasing in his sight.3:23 And this is his commandment, that we should believe on the Name of his son Jesus Christ, and love one another, as he gave us commandment.3:24 And he that observes his commandments abides in him, and he in him. And by this we know that he abides in us, by the Spirit that he has given us.
4:1 Beloved, believe not every spirit, but examine the spirits whether they are of Elohim: because many false prophets are gone out into the world.4:2 By this you know the Spirit of Elohim: Every spirit that agrees that Jesus Christ has come in the flesh is of Elohim:4:3 And every spirit that agrees not that Jesus Christ has come in the flesh is not of Elohim: and this is that spirit of Antichrist, which you have heard that it should come; and even now already it is in the world.4:4 You are of Elohim, little children, and have overcome them: because greater is he that is in you, than he that is in the world.4:5 They are of the world: therefore they speak of the world, and the world hears them.4:6 We are of Elohim: those that know Elohim hear us; those that are not of Elohim hear us not. By this we know the Spirit of Truth, and the spirit of error.4:7 Beloved, let us love dearly one another: for Love is of Elohim; and everyone that dearly loves is begotten of Elohim, and knows Elohim.4:8 Those that do not love dearly know not Elohim; because Elohim is Love (Agape).4:9 In this was made visible the Love of Elohim toward us, because that Elohim sent his only begotten Son into the world, that we might live through him.4:10 This is Love, not that we dearly loved Elohim, but that he dearly loved us, and sent his Son to be the propitiation for our sins.4:11 Beloved, if Elohim so loved us, we should also love one another.4:12 No one has seen Elohim at any time. If we dearly love one another, Elohim abides in us, and his Love is made perfect in us.4:13 By this we know that we remain in him, and he in us, because he has given us of his Spirit.4:14 And we have seen and do testify that the Father sent the Son to be the Savior of the world.4:15 Whoever will confess that Jesus is the Son of Elohim, Elohim abides in him, and he in Elohim.4:16 And we have known and believed the Love that Elohim has for us. Elohim is Love; and they that remains in Love abide in Elohim, and Elohim in them.4:17 By this is our Love made perfect, that we may have boldness in the Day of Judgment: because as he is, so are we in this world.4:18 There is no dread in Love; but perfect brotherly love casts out dread: because dread has punishment. Those that dread are not made perfect in Love.4:19 We dearly love him, because he first dearly loved us.4:20 If a person says, I dearly love Elohim but hates their brother, they are a liar: for they that love not their brother who they have seen, how can they dearly love Elohim who they have not seen?4:21 And this commandment we have from him, That they who dearly love Elohim Love their brother also.
5:1 Everyone who is believing that Jesus is the Christ, of Elohim they have been begotten, and everyone who is loving him who did beget, does love also him who is begotten of him.5:2 By this we know that we love the children of Elohim, when we love Elohim, and observe his commandments.5:3 Because this is the Love of Elohim, that we observe his commandments: and his commandments are not grievous.5:4 For whoever is begotten of Elohim overcomes the world: and this is the victory that overcomes the world, even our Faith.5:5 Who is he that overcomes the world but he that believes that Jesus is the Son of Elohim? 5:6 This is he that came by water and blood, even Jesus Christ; not by water only, but by water and blood. And it is the Spirit that bears witness, because the Spirit is Truth.5:7 [Omitted, from perverted Latin Vulgate] 5:8 The Spirit, and the Water, and the Blood; And the three are witnesses unto one thing.5:9 If we receive the witness of men, the witness of Elohim is greater: for this is the witness of Elohim that he has testified of his Son.5:10 Those that believes on the Son of Elohim have the witness in themselves: those that believes not Elohim have made him a liar; because they believed not the record that Elohim gave from his Son.5:11 And this is the record, that Elohim has given to us Age-Lasting Life, and this Life is in his Son.5:12 Those that have the Son have Life; and those that have not the Son of Elohim have not Life.5:13 These things have I written to you that believe on the Name of the Son of Elohim; that you may know that you have Age-Lasting Life, and that you may believe on the Name of the Son of Elohim.5:14 And this is the confidence that we have in him, that if we ask anything according to his will, he hears us:5:15 And if we know that he hear us, whatever we ask, we know that we have the petitions that we desired of him.5:16 If anyone sees their brother sin a sin that is not unto death, he will ask, and he will give him life for them that sin not unto death. There is a sin unto death: I do not say that they will pray for it.5:17 All unrighteousness is sin: and there is a sin not unto death.5:18 We know that whoever is begotten of Elohim sins not; but they that are begotten of Elohim guard themselves so that the wicked one touches them not.5:19 And we know that we are of Elohim, and the whole world lies in peril.5:20 And we know that the Son of Elohim has come, and has given us an understanding that we may know him that is real, and we are in him that is real, even in his son Jesus Christ. This is the Real Elohim, and Age- Lasting Life.5:21 Little children, guard yourselves from false elohim. Amen.
II John
1:1 The elder to the elect Christian woman and her children, who I am fond of in the Truth; and not I only, but also all they that have known the Truth;1:2 By the means of the reality that abides in us, and will be with us for the ages.1:3 Grace be with you, mercy and peace, from YHWH Elohim the Father, and from the LORD Jesus Christ, the Son of the Father, in Truth and Love.1:4 I rejoiced greatly that I found some of your children walking in Truth, as we have received a commandment from the Father.1:5 And now I entreat you, Christian woman, not as though I wrote a new commandment to you, but what we had from the beginning, that we dearly love one another.1:6 This is Love, that we walk after his commandments. This is the commandment, that as you have heard from the beginning, you should walk in it.1:7 For many deceivers are entered into the world, who do not confess that Jesus Christ has come in the flesh. This is a deceiver and an antichrist.1:8 Look to yourselves, that we lose not those things that we have acquired, but that we receive a full wage.1:9 Whoever transgresses, and does not remain in the Doctrine of Christ, has not Elohim. He that abides in the Doctrine of Christ, he has both the Father and the Son.1:10 If there come any to you, and bring not This Doctrine, receive him not into your house, neither bid him salutations:1:11 For he that bids him salutations is partaker of his bad undertakings.1:12 Having many things to write to you, I would not write with paper and ink: but I trust to come to you, and speak face to face that our joy may be full.1:13 The children of your elect sister welcomes your. Amen.
III John
1:1 The elder to the esteemed Gaius, who I love in the Truth.1:2 Beloved, I wish above all things that you may prosper and be in health, even as your life prospers.1:3 For I rejoiced greatly, when the brethren came and testified of the Truth that is in you, even as you walk in the Truth.1:4 I have no greater joy than to hear that my children walk in Truth.1:5 Beloved, you are faithful in what you are doing for the brethren, even though they are foreigners to you.1:6 That have witnessed of your Love before the ekklesia: and you will do well to send them on their way well cared for, as is right for slaves of Elohim.1:7 Because that for his Name's sake they went out, taking nothing from the Gentiles.1:8 We therefore should receive such ones, that we might be fellow workers to the Truth.1:9 I wrote to the ekklesia: but Diotrephes, who loved to have the preeminence among them, received us not.1:10 Therefore, if I come, I will remember his deeds that he did, prating against us with malicious words: and not content therein, neither did he himself receive the brethren, and forbid them that would, and cast them out of the ekklesia.1:11 Beloved, follow not what is bad, but what is good. He that does good is of Elohim: but he that does evil has not seen Elohim.1:12 Demetrius has a good report of all men, and of the Truth itself: yes, and we also bear record; and you know that our record is truthful.1:13 I had many things to write, but I will not with ink and pen write to you:1:14 But I trust I will shortly see you, and we will speak face to face. Peace be to you. Our friends salute you. Greet the friends by name.
Jude
1:1 Jude, the slave of Jesus Christ and brother of James, to them that are consecrated by Elohim the Father, and guarded by Jesus Christ and called:1:2 Mercy to you, and peace and love be multiplied.1:3 Beloved, when I gave all diligence to write to you of the common salvation, it was needful for me to write to you and exhort you that you should earnestly contend for the Faith that was once delivered to the saints.1:4 For there are some men crept in unawares, who were designated beforehand long ago to this condemnation, ungodly men, turning the Grace of our Elohim into licentiousness, and denying the only MASTER YHWH Elohim, and our LORD Jesus Christ.1:5 I will therefore put you in remembrance, though you once knew this, how that the LORD, having saved the people out of the land of Egypt, afterward destroyed them that believed not.1:6 And the angels that kept not their first estate, but left their own habitation, he has reserved in age-abiding chains under darkness to the Judgment of the Great Day.1:7 Even as Sodom and Gomorrha, and the cities around them in the same way, gave themselves over to fornication, and going after different flesh, are set forth for an example, suffering the vengeance of age- lasting fire.1:8 Likewise also these filthy dreamers defile the flesh, despise dominion, and speak evil of dignities.1:9 Yet Michael the archangel, when contending with the Devil, he disputed about the body of Moses but did not bring against him a railing accusation, but said, the LORD adjudge you.1:10 But these speak evil of those things that they know not: but what they know naturally, as brute beasts, in those things they corrupt themselves.1:11 Woe unto them! for they have gone in the way of Cain, and ran greedily after the error of Balaam for reward, and perished in the rebellion of Core.1:12 These are spots in your love feasts, when they feast with you, feeding themselves without fear: clouds they are without water, carried about of winds; trees whose fruit withers, without fruit, twice dead, plucked up by the roots;1:13 Raging waves of the sea, foaming out their own shame; wandering stars, to whom is reserved the Blackness of Darkness for the ages.1:14 And Enoch also, the 7th from Adam, prophesied of these saying, Behold, the LORD comes with 10,000's of his saints,1:15 To execute judgment upon all, and to convict all that are ungodly among them of all their ungodly deeds that they have ungodly committed, and of all their hard speeches that ungodly sinners have spoken against him.1:16 These are murmurers, complainers, walking after their own lusts; and their mouth speaking great swelling words, giving admiration to persons for the sake of profit.1:17 But beloved, remember you the words that were spoken before by the Apostles of our LORD Jesus Christ;1:18 How that they told you there would be mockers in the Last Time, who would walk after their own ungodly lusts.1:19 These are they who separate themselves, sensual, having not the Spirit.1:20 But you, beloved, building up yourselves on your Most Holy Faith, praying in the Sacred Spirit,1:21 Guard yourselves in the Love of Elohim, looking for the mercy of our LORD Jesus Christ unto Age- Lasting Life.1:22 And of some have compassion, making a difference:1:23 But others save with fear, pulling them out of the fire; hating even the garment spotted by the flesh.1:24 Now to him that is able to guard you from falling, and to present you faultless before the presence of His glory with exceeding joy,1:25 to the only wise Elohim our Savior, is glory and majesty, dominion and power, both now and for the ages. Amen.
